When I work every day there are no issues, when I take a couple days off and it sits for a day or 2 its a little hard starting and then has missfire/rough runnning letting it warm up for a couple minutes and then for about a block from the house it clears right up. No smoke what so ever out of the exhaust and no codes.
I'm guessing there's an internal oil leak that bleeds off over time and is causing some air to get into the HPOP oil pump or rail? Any common areas that can cause this or is it something else?
The truck is an 02 with 233000kms (145000 miles) on it.

The next time it gets to sit for a few days, take a minute and check the oil level in the HPOP reservoir. It should be within an inch of the top. There is a check ball that is supposed to keep the oil from draining back into the pan. perhaps yours isn't doing that.
